Output 45f2bcbb858b986ab6dc8fb89d990eb7fb4feaf89bbd18fc92fc1327c15ded2e:2

value
19579203
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1dff551e7a387e5303e1f1495deb75bbdab1573 OP_EQUALVERIFY OP_CHECKSIG
address
LeMfnCYAiExe7oD2c8nL15qiHx7XhKGfs5
transaction
45f2bcbb858b986ab6dc8fb89d990eb7fb4feaf89bbd18fc92fc1327c15ded2e
spent
true